Charles E. "Chuck" Johnson Sr. "Pap"'s Obituary
Charles E. “Chuck” Johnson Sr. “Pap”, age 80, of North Ridgeville, passed away at his home on June 20, 2015.
He was born on December 20, 1934 in Green County, PA and has lived in North Ridgeville for the past 53 years. He was an automotive worker at General Motors, retiring in 1989 and worked as a mechanic at the Lake Ridge Academy for many years.
Chuck was a member of the V.F.W. Post 9871 Men's Auxiliary in North Ridgeville and the Eagles Club.
Chuck was the consummate, fun loving gentleman, who always had a smile on his face and was ever willing to lend a helping hand to a friend or neighbor. Family came first, and he cared for and lived with his disabled brother Lewis for many years. He loved his grandchildren, fishing with them often and never missed one of their sporting events. The summer months would find him working in his garden, and in his spare time, he enjoyed singing and dancing.
He is survived by his wife Cynthia (nee Cockrell); sons Ralph, Charles E. Jr. (Grace) and Robert (Janice) Johnson, all of Grafton; grandchildren Rachel Britt, Amanda Corsino, Tyler and Chase Johnson and Jackie Pettry ; great grandchildren Isabella Johnson, Brandon and Lana Hovanitz, Raizo Corsino and Caiden Randolph; sister Rhea (John) Yardley; brother James (Joyce) Johnson; uncle of many.
Chuck was preceded in death by his first wife, Olive; grandson Josh Johnson; parents Elliot and Mildred (nee Gough) Johnson; brothers William and Lewis Johnson; brother- in-law Edward Brajdic.
